Job Title: Remote Area Administrator
Location: Eastern Washington (remotely serving areas across Region of WA/ID/MT/WY)
Employment Type: Part-Time - up to 25 hours
Compensation: Hourly (starting at approx. $20/hour based on qualifications and experience)
Overview:
The Mountain West Region is seeking a dedicated individual to provide comprehensive administrative support for multiple areas across the Region (Eastern Washington, North Idaho, Montana, and Northern Wyoming) as well as the Regional staff team. This role will involve assisting staff members with various tasks, both data-oriented and relational, to enhance their effectiveness in leading their respective areas and teams. The ideal candidate will be proactive, resourceful, and possess strong communication skills to collaborate effectively with multiple teams remotely. Candidate is required to live within 90 minutes of Spokane, WA.

Responsibilities:
Proactive Engagement: Anticipate and address the administrative needs of each area 1-3 months ahead of time. Management of lists and spreadsheets related to donors, community outreach, leaders, students, etc. Work alongside area staff to drive tasks remotely, ensuring timely completion and alignment with organizational goals.
Task Management: Receive weekly task and action item assignments from each area and regional team. Coordinate with area and regional staff to prioritize tasks and ensure clarity on expectations.
System Proficiency: Become proficient in Young Life's major systems including: Workday, YL Connect, Google Suite, WebConnex, Tofino Auctions, and social media. Utilize these systems to create resources and support area and regional staff as needed.
Communication Strategy and Execution: Collaborate with areas and the regional team to develop communication plans with donors and communities, ensuring quality and consistency in sharing the vision of Young Life.
Graphic Design : Use graphic tools to create visuals (flyers, reports, presentations, social media, etc) for a variety of audiences.
Camp System Support: Provide focused support within the camping systems, especially during the periods leading up to each area's camp trips. Communicating with parents, tracking camp payments and designing systems to manage fundraisers and ordering supplies.
Event Support: Assist with 1-2 events per year for each area. Offering in-person help as requested and discerned by the team. Provide focused support of event logistics and anticipation of upcoming tasks and workflow.
